J & J Auto Sales

104 fenmar dr M9L1M5 North york Ontario Canada
  • Profile: J & J Auto Sales is a Automotive Dealers and Gasoline Service Stations company located at North york, Ontario Canada, address is 104 fenmar dr, North york M9L1M5 ON, postcode is M9L1M5
Please share as much information as you can about J & J Auto Sales so other users can benefit from your comment.